Home Foundation Leveling in Tampa, FL
Home fo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ions. This process is commonly requested for residential properties experiencing issues such as c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ects typically include assessing the foundation’s current state, then using specialized techniques to lift or realign the structure, helping to restore stability and prevent further damage.
Property owners considering foundation leveling often want to understand what signs indicate the need for service, the methods used during the process, and how it can impact the longevity of the home. It’s important to evaluate the extent of foundation movement, the types of soil and foundation materials involved, and any potential structural concerns before proceeding.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and restores the structural integrity of settling or shifting foundations.
Basement Leveling - corrects uneven floors and prevents future cracks or damage.
Slab Jacking -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ces around the property.
Pier and Beam Leveling - addresses uneven or sagging floors caused by foundation movement.
Crack Repair - seals and reinforces fo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il support to reduce future foundation movement and settling.
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es foundation settling? Foundation settling can occur due to soil moisture changes, poor drainage, or natural soil movement beneath the structure.
How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What types of projects typically require foundation leveling? Common projects include correcting uneven slabs, stabilizing settling foundations, and addressing structural shifts in residential properties.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of foundations? Foundation leveling is effective for many types, including concrete slabs and pier-and-beam structures, depending on the condition of the foundation.
